Habe eine Schaltung wie oben im Bild aufgebaut, habe aber das Problem das der Ausgang des BD136 dauerhaft geschaltet ist. Woran könnte dies liegen ? Gesteuert wird alles mit ein Atmega.
>Woran könnte dies liegen ?
Das liegt an den Dioden im ULN die du per COM
an 5V angeschlossen hast.
Wie könnte ich dieses ändern, oder was könnte man am besten ändern ?
HansWerner schrieb: > Wie könnte ich dieses ändern, oder was könnte man am besten ändern? Häng COM an die 12V oder wenn du keine induktiven Lasten hast kannst du es auch unbeschalten lassen.
Da die induktive Last – sofern existent – vermutlich am BD136 angeschlossen ist, ist es einerlei, ob man COM ab +12V anschließt oder offen lässt.
Die Frage ist ob der Schutz vor Induktionsspannung noch gegeben ist ?
HansWerner schrieb: > Die Frage ist ob der Schutz vor Induktionsspannung noch gegeben ist ? Der BD136 ist keine Induktivität und demzufolge braucht der ULN keinen Schutz.
HansWerner schrieb: > Die Frage ist ob der Schutz vor Induktionsspannung noch gegeben ist ? Dazu müsste eine Diode über den BD136, nicht den ULN
1 | ---R---+--R--+ |
2 | | | |
3 | +--+--BD136---+-- +12V |
4 | | | | |
5 | | +---|>|----+ |
6 | | |
7 | +--- |
:
Bearbeitet durch User
MaWin schrieb: > Dazu müsste eine Diode über den BD136, nicht den ULN Nicht über den BD136, sondern über die Last, die am BD136 hängt, also vermutlich von GND zum Kollektor des BD136.
:
Bearbeitet durch Moderator
Der Grundgedanke war eigentlich folgender: mit dem BD136 wird eine Spule geschaltet, da diese beim ein und ausschalten hohe Spannung erzeugt und nicht zum MC gelangen soll, wollte ich diese mit der intrigierten Diode des ULN 2806 ableiten.
HansWerner schrieb: > wollte > ich diese mit der intrigierten Diode des ULN 2806 ableiten. Das hilft aber nicht viel, weil hier der BD136 die Brille aufhat, bzw. die Gegen-EMK abbekommen würde. Also machs so, wie Yalu sagt.
Die Diode kann nicht direkt an der Spule montiert werden. Gibt es auch eine einfache Lösung z.B. ein Dioden Array weil ich mehrere Spulen ansteuern möchte. Kann leider nicht finden.
@ HansWerner (Gast) >Die Diode kann nicht direkt an der Spule montiert werden. Das muss sie auch gar nicht. Sondern am Ausgangstransistor. >Gibt es auch eine einfache Lösung z.B. ein Dioden Array weil ich mehrere >Spulen ansteuern möchte. Nö. Nimm eine handvoll Dioden und sei glücklich.
Die Schaltung soll vielfach gebaut werden, es wäre dann natürlich schön wenn es eine zeitsparende Möglichkeit gibt als jedesmal eine Dioden einzulöten
HansWerne schrieb: > Die Schaltung soll vielfach gebaut werden, es wäre dann natürlich schön > wenn es eine zeitsparende Möglichkeit gibt als jedesmal eine Dioden > einzulöten Welchen Strom brauchen Deine Spulen denn? Wenn Du sagst: HansWerner schrieb: > Der Grundgedanke war eigentlich folgender: > mit dem BD136 wird eine Spule geschaltet, da diese beim ein und > ausschalten hohe Spannung erzeugt und nicht zum MC gelangen soll, wollte > ich diese mit der intrigierten Diode des ULN 2806 ableiten. ... reicht der ULN ja vielleicht direkt. Dann kannst Du seine internen Dioden auch nutzen. Gruß Dietrich
HansWerne schrieb: > Die Schaltung soll vielfach gebaut werden, es wäre dann natürlich schön > wenn es eine zeitsparende Möglichkeit gibt als jedesmal eine Dioden > einzulöten Du wirst hinterher auf jeden Fall mehr Probleme haben: mit ausgefallenen Transistoren, mit Störungen, mit Einkopplungen in deine Schaltung. Damit verglichen ist das Einlöten von Dioden m.E. die attraktivste Möglichkeit, seine Zeit zu verbringen...
Da ich die Diode nicht direkt an der Spule montieren kann bleibt mir meiner Meinung nach nur die Möglichkeit die Diode am Transistor zu platzieren. Siehe Bild
HansWerner schrieb: > Da ich die Diode nicht direkt an der Spule montieren kann Das ist ganz einfach Unsinn. Der eine Anschluss der Diode ist der Transistor-Ausgang, der andere Masse - wieso kannst du da nichts anschliessen? Deine Schaltung begrenzt auch die Induktionsspannung, speist den Strom aber zurück in die 12V-Versorgung, das kann unerwünschte Nebeneffekte haben bei grossen Induktivitäten. Steigt dadurch die Versorgung über 12V, kann alles was dran hängt vernichtet werden. Georg
Es handelt sich bei der Spule um ein Magnetventil welches der Kunde montieren soll. Da ich kein Risiko eingehen will, falls einer der Kunden mal die Diode vergisst.
@ HansWerner (Gast) >Da ich die Diode nicht direkt an der Spule montieren kann Du kannst lesen? Beitrag "Re: ULN 2803 + BD136 schaltet nicht" >bleibt mir >meiner Meinung nach nur die Möglichkeit die Diode am Transistor zu >platzieren. Siehe Bild So nicht! Die Polung stimmt, aber die Anschlüsse nicht! Die Dioden muss zwischen GND und Relaisausgang (=Transistorkollektor)
@ Georg (Gast) >> Da ich die Diode nicht direkt an der Spule montieren kann >Das ist ganz einfach Unsinn. Der eine Anschluss der Diode ist der >Transistor-Ausgang, der andere Masse - wieso kannst du da nichts >anschliessen? In der Tat! >Deine Schaltung begrenzt auch die Induktionsspannung, speist den Strom >aber zurück in die 12V-Versorgung, Nö. Denn die ist beim Abschalten NEGATIV. Da wird bestenfalls die Sperrspannung der Diode oder des Transistors überschritten. Rückspeisen kann man nur, wenn man beide Pole der Spule schalten kann, wie z.B. hier. Beitrag "Re: Kondensator mit Überspannung laden"
@ HansWerner (Gast) > Unbenannt.JPG >sorry natürlich die Diode anders herum GND sollte aber auch als GND erkennbar sein.
HansWerner schrieb: > sorry natürlich die Diode anders herum Vielleicht solltest du dir angewöhnen, Schaltpläne verständlicher zu zeichen. Dazu zeichnet man + nach oben, - oder GND nach unten. Dann sind solche Fehler eher zu erkennen! Siehe dazu die richtige Schaltung, die Yalu bereits um 10:56 gepostet hatte: https://www.mikrocontroller.net/attachment/263202/freilaufdiode.png. Gruß Dietrich
@ Dietrich L. (dietrichl) >Vielleicht solltest du dir angewöhnen, Schaltpläne verständlicher zu >zeichen. >Dazu zeichnet man + nach oben, - oder GND nach unten. Dann sind solche >Fehler eher zu erkennen! In der Tat! Schaltplan richtig zeichnen
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.